Aptma rejects gas price hike for export-oriented units

LAHORE: The All Pakistan Textile Mills Association (Aptma) has rejected the sudden hike in gas prices from $6.5/mmbtu to $9/mmbtu for the export-oriented units. Gas supply suspended to the Gas stations, SSGC

gas prices

KARACHI: The Sui Southern Gas Company (SSGC) on Friday announced that the gas supply to the compressed natural gas (CNG) stations will be suspended every Sunday for 24 hours. ECC to approve increase in gas tariffs around the country

Gas

The Economic Coordination Committee (ECC) of the cabinet is likely to approve increase in gas tariffs by up to 214 percent for certain consumer categories.
